Transaction 3383808114be57cb99cdc5fc9968f780adea0822bab0ef2b3e89bcb910b83be7
1 Input
1 Output
-
3383808114be57cb99cdc5fc9968f780adea0822bab0ef2b3e89bcb910b83be7:0
- value
- 473149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f105941f11aa9d03d9e2377e3018de3471c99852 OP_EQUAL
- address
- 3PfRTP9obDLS24zmMpJSXYL2CZ1vJY4ysu